France establishes its roadmap for 5G and launches four priority courses of action
Delphine Gény-Stephann, Secretary of State for Economic Affairs and Finance, attached to the Prime Minister, Mounir Mahjoubi, Secretary of State for Digital Affairs, attached to the Prime Minister and Arcep Chair, Sébastien Soriano, presented the 5G roadmap for France on Monday, 16 July.

Arcep expands its "mon réseau mobile" mapping tool to include France's overseas departments
Today Arcep is publishing the coverage maps and quality of service findings for mobile operators in the French overseas departments on its monreseaumobile.fr website. As stated in the overseas Blue Paper submitted to the President of France on 28 June 2018, this publication allows consumers in the overseas markets to compare operators' performance, and for public policymakers to obtain an diagnosis on the state of mobile connectivity in their region. All of the data are available as open data files.

Regulating competition in the wholesale market for terrestrial TV broadcasting: In its “scoreboard and outlook” Arcep recommends not renewing its regulation
Arcep is publishing its “scoreboard and outlook” document for public consultation, which traditionally marks the start of a new round of market analysis.
